Reproduction of optical information by one-beam optics with reduced crosstalk as recorded in multi-phases and multi-levels at staggered lattice points, and apparatus and recording medium therefor

Learning marks are recorded in a learning region preceding a data recording region of the track. The positions of information recording lattice points are staggered by one lattice point between two contiguous tracks. At reading of recorded information, a two-dimensional information leakage amount is detected by the reproduced signals from a learning mark preceding a target information recording lattice point on a track, and from the information recording lattice points immediately before and after the learning mark in question. The equalization coefficients are calculated from leakage amount thus obtained. The crosstalk present in a reproduced signal for the target lattice point is removed by using this equalization coefficients and a pair of reproduced signals from intermediate lattice points which are located immediately before and after the current lattice point and which are not used to record information marks. Inter-symbol interference left in the crosstalk- removed reproduced signal is further removed by use of the reproduced signals from a plurality of information recording lattice points which are located immediately before and after the target lattice point.
